Details of Eazy-E's Funeral and Passing
The influential rapper and music executive Eazy-E, whose real name was Eric Lynn Wright, was buried on April 7, 1995, at Rose Hills Memorial Park in Whittier, California. His passing occurred shortly after his diagnosis, marking a significant loss in the music world.
Key Dates Surrounding Eazy-E's Death and Burial
Event | Date | Details |
---|---|---|
Death | March 26, 1995 | Died from complications due to HIV/AIDS. |
Funeral/Burial | April 7, 1995 | Buried at Rose Hills Memorial Park, Whittier, CA. |
Eazy-E died at the age of 30, approximately one month after publicly announcing his HIV/AIDS diagnosis. While some contemporary reports cited his age as 31, this was due to an earlier falsification of his birth date. His funeral was a somber event, attended by many figures from the music industry and his personal life, reflecting his profound impact on gangsta rap and hip-hop.
